Story confirming he holds a canadian passport and would be open to representing canada.

http://www.wakingthered.com/2015/8/15/9159121/shrewsbury-keeper-jayson-leutwiler-would-consider-playing-for-canada-passport

Waking the Red has received confirmation from Shrewsbury Town that Leutwiler does in fact have a Canadian passport, on top of the Swiss passport that was already well known.

Leutwiler has yet to be approached by the Canadian Soccer Association, but Waking The Red has learned he would consider joining the team should they give him the option.
